tjetër
Albanian
Alternative forms
Etymology
T- from plural (from ligature particle të) + archaic singular (Arbëresh) jetër, from Proto-Albanian *étera sg, *etérai pl, from Proto-Indo-European *h₁e-tero- (compare Latin cēterus (“the other one”), Umbrian etro- (“another”), Old Church Slavonic етеръ (eterŭ, “someone”), Avestan 𐬀𐬙𐬁𐬭𐬀 (atāra, “this one of the two”)).
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/tje.tər/
Adjective
i tjetër m (feminine e tjetër, masculine plural të tjerë, feminine plural të tjerat)
Noun
tjetër ? (indefinite plural të tjerë, definite singular tjetri)
